THE DOWERY is a small privately operated
Nursery located in the Blue Ridge Mountains of Virginia. Established in 1991,
our primary purpose is to collect, propagate and deliver the finest (and
sometimes most obscure) species available. For the past few years we have
begun to emphasize species from various countries of the Pacific Rim, where it
seems there is an endless number of interesting and unusual orchid genera - and
occasionally even undiscovered species. In our current list we offer one
new species - PHAL DOWERYENSIS, and a number of rare or uncommon species.
For the past two years we have imported considerable numbers of 'jewel' orchids (Anoectochilus, Dossinia, Goodyeara, Ludisia, Macodes and Malaxis). These terrestrials, whose leaves are most attractive, are generally easy to grow, if given ample moisture, shade, a humid environment with good air movement and a medium that is reflective of their natural setting. This year we have added two very diminutive unidentified species; one that may prove to be of the Zeuxine genus and the second may be a Malaxis species. Both will bloom this year and when they do, we should be able to identify them correctly. Both appear to be very easy growers.
